-
参数:
data
:它可以是一个字典、array-like
、标量。表示Series
包含的数据,如果是序列/数组,则它必须是一维的- 如果是字典,则字典的键指定了
label
。如果你同时使用了index
,则以index
为准。 - 如果是标量,则结果为:该标量扩充为
index
长度相同的列表。 index
:一个array-like
或者一个Index
对象。它指定了label
。其值必须唯一而且hashable
,且长度与data
一致。如果data
是一个字典,则index
将会使用该字典的key
(此时index
不起作用)。如果未提供,则使用np.arange(n)
。name
:一个字符串,为Series
的名字。- :指定数据类型。如果为
None
,则数据类型被自动推断
还可以通过类方法创建
Series
:Series.from_array(arr, index=None, name=None, dtype=None,
copy=False, fastpath=False)
:其中arr
可以是一个字典、array-like
、标量。其他参数见1.-
.to_dict()
:转换成字典,格式为{label->value}
.to_frame([name])
:转换成DataFrame
。name
为Index
的名字.tolist()
:转换成列表
-
buf
:一个StringIO-like
对象,是写入的float_format
:浮点数的格式化函数。应用于浮点列header
:一个布尔值。如果为True
,则添加头部信息(index name
)index
:一个布尔值。如果为True
,则添加index labels
length
:一个布尔值。如果为True
,则添加Series
的长度信息dtype
:一个布尔值。如果为True
,则添加dtype
信息name
:一个布尔值。如果为True
,则添加Series name
max_rows
:一个整数值,给出了最大转换的行数。如果为None
,则转换全部。
返回转换后的字符串。